Job Summary and Qualifications
The Internal Control Director provides operational direction and oversight for master file activities and other internal control functions supporting all consolidated service centers (CSC), facilities, and patient accounting. The Internal Control Director is responsible for developing, directing, communicating and analyzing item and vendor file integrity to ensure appropriateness and accuracy. The Internal Control Director will also be responsible for developing training materials, policies and procedures and ultimately recommending processes for implementing controls for improvement of operations.
What you will do in this role includes:
- Direct and oversee the item, vendor and procedure code master file add/maintenance processes
- Develop relationships with CSC Procure-to-Pay departments, HPG Standardization and Contracting to ensure master files are maintained and assist with resolution of discrepancies with vendors
- Oversee review of master files and reporting to ensure accurate, complete and updated information
- Develop and oversee the procedure code add process for supply items, including coordination with Supply Revenue Analysts and Chargemaster and update of chargeability data in SICAM
- Optimize the use of the SMART system by maximizing EDI, automated invoicing and automated ordering and demonstrate a comprehensive understanding of the SMART system
- Oversee initial setup of new COIDs, including item, vendor, procedure code and GL master file data
- Direct, oversee and coordinate information requirements and data management for facility Acquisitions and Divestitures
- Facilitate the development and maintenance of policies, procedures, goals and objectives to meet the department's mission
- Comply with and enforce all internal control and legal policies, including the physician owned / physician related policies (LL.001, LL.027, LL.029)
- Ensure the day-to-day activities of all internal control employees are managed. Oversee the hiring, development, and training of personnel, and provide a reservoir of professional talent
- Monitor the department and report performance measures to ensure performance meets or exceeds standards
- Identifies, interprets, and reports trends in performance measurement data and recommends analytical or operational changes to maximize financial and operational effectiveness and efficiency of the internal control team.
- Collaborates with corporate supply chain and CSC leadership to develop strategic direction, operational improvements and sharing of best practices.
- Maintain a high degree of communication, cooperation and coordination with facility and CSC staff and user departments
- Maintain good records and controls which provide an audit trail for all duties performed
- Develop processes and associated policies and procedures to support the Pharmacy Distribution function and processes.
- Manages and executes new Supply Chain initiatives as assigned
What Qualifications you will need:
-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Business Management, Healthcare Administration, or similar field Required
Three to five years of Purchasing, Accounts Payable, Supply Revenue, Internal Control experience in a progressive and integrated material management environment Preferred
- Experience in Healthcare or related supply industries Preferred
